Anyway, this isn't one to worry about. The phone company knows and records the IMEI number of your phone, so they will know how long you have been using it with your current service.
They'll know how long you have been using it, but not necessarily whether you own it - unless they actually supplied it. The IMEI is specific to the handset, and you could buy or swap a phone to use with your SIM.

Now, the IMSI and the Sim Serial Number, which are specific to the SIM - the operator can vouch for those having been issued to you - if it's a contract or registered phone. But if its an unregistered pay-as-you-go phone, then who's to say you haven't nicked it, SIM and all?
